    Entenmann's Fat-Free Oatmeal Raisin Cookies

    Recipe By :
    Serving Size : 48 Preparation Time :0:00
    Categories : Desserts Cookies
    Low-Fat

    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method
    -------- ------------ --------------------------------
    -----WALDINE VAN GEFFEN VGHC42A-----
    1 tablespoon Molasses
    3 Raw egg whites
    1 cup Dark raisins
    1 1/2 teaspoons Vanilla
    1 cup Light brown sugar -- packed
    1 cup Granulated sugar
    1/2 cup Non-fat dry milk powder
    1/2 teaspoon Cinnamon
    1 1/2 teaspoons Baking powder
    2 1/2 cups Quaker brand quick-cooking -- rolled oats
    1 cup All-purpose flour

    Put molasses, egg whites and raisins into blender and blend on high speed
    just to mince but not to puree (about 5-10 seconds). Empty mixture into
    medium mixing bowl. With mixer beat in on medium speed each of the
    remaining ingredients, beating well after each addition, adding both the
    oats and flour in small portions. Switch to mixing spoon if dough becomes
    too stiff for mixer. Lightly spray cookie sheet with Pam and wipe off
    excess lightly with paper towel; any excess of the cookie sheet may burn
    while cookies are baking. You need only a very light film of the Pam just
    to keep cookies from sticking. Use 1 measuring teaspoonful of dough for
    each cookie and place 2" apart on prepared cookie sheet. Bake in preheated
    350~ oven 6-8 minutes. Do not overbake. Cool on paper towels, removing
    from cookie sheets carefully.
